O que é: Ping
O termo “ping” refere-se a uma ferramenta de rede utilizada para testar a conectividade entre dois dispositivos em uma rede de computadores. O ping funciona enviando pacotes de dados, conhecidos como “pacotes ICMP Echo Request”, para um endereço IP específico e aguardando uma resposta, chamada de “Echo Reply”. Essa técnica é fundamental para diagnosticar problemas de rede, medir latência e verificar se um dispositivo está acessível. O ping é amplamente utilizado por administradores de rede e profissionais de TI para monitorar a saúde e a performance de redes.
Como funciona o Ping
O funcionamento do ping é relativamente simples. Quando um usuário executa o comando ping em um terminal ou prompt de comando, o software gera pacotes ICMP e os envia ao endereço IP de destino. O dispositivo de destino, ao receber esses pacotes, responde com pacotes de retorno. O tempo que leva para o pacote ir e voltar é medido em milissegundos (ms) e é conhecido como latência. Essa métrica é crucial para avaliar a velocidade de resposta de uma rede e pode influenciar diretamente a experiência do usuário em aplicações online, como jogos e streaming.
Importância do Ping em Redes de Computadores
O ping desempenha um papel vital na manutenção e no gerenciamento de redes de computadores. Ele permite que os administradores identifiquem rapidamente se um dispositivo está offline, se há problemas de conectividade ou se a latência está acima do normal. Além disso, o ping pode ajudar a diagnosticar problemas de roteamento, já que uma resposta negativa pode indicar que o pacote não conseguiu alcançar o destino devido a falhas na rede. Dessa forma, o ping é uma ferramenta essencial para garantir a eficiência e a confiabilidade das comunicações em rede.
Interpretação dos Resultados do Ping
Os resultados do comando ping geralmente incluem informações como o número de pacotes enviados, recebidos e perdidos, além do tempo mínimo, máximo e médio de resposta. Um resultado ideal é aquele em que todos os pacotes são recebidos e a latência é baixa. Por outro lado, a perda de pacotes ou tempos de resposta elevados podem indicar congestionamento na rede, problemas de hardware ou configurações inadequadas. A análise cuidadosa desses resultados permite que os profissionais de TI tomem decisões informadas sobre a manutenção e a otimização da rede.
Ping e Latência
A latência, frequentemente medida pelo ping, é um fator crítico em aplicações que exigem tempo real, como videoconferências e jogos online. Latências elevadas podem resultar em atrasos perceptíveis, prejudicando a experiência do usuário. Em geral, uma latência abaixo de 20 ms é considerada excelente, enquanto valores entre 20 ms e 50 ms são aceitáveis para a maioria das aplicações. Latências acima de 100 ms podem começar a causar problemas significativos, especialmente em ambientes onde a rapidez de resposta é crucial.
Ping e Segurança de Rede
Embora o ping seja uma ferramenta útil para diagnóstico de rede, ele também pode ser explorado em ataques de negação de serviço (DoS). Ataques de ping, como o “ping flood”, envolvem o envio de um grande número de pacotes ICMP para um dispositivo, sobrecarregando-o e tornando-o incapaz de responder a solicitações legítimas. Por esse motivo, muitos administradores de rede implementam medidas de segurança para limitar ou bloquear pacotes ICMP, protegendo assim seus sistemas contra possíveis abusos.
Alternativas ao Ping
Existem várias ferramentas e comandos que podem ser utilizados como alternativas ao ping para testes de conectividade e desempenho de rede. O comando “traceroute”, por exemplo, permite que os usuários visualizem o caminho que os pacotes de dados percorrem até o destino, identificando possíveis pontos de falha ao longo do caminho. Outras ferramentas, como “mtr” (My Traceroute), combinam as funcionalidades do ping e do traceroute, oferecendo uma visão mais abrangente da saúde da rede.
Limitações do Ping
Apesar de sua utilidade, o ping possui algumas limitações. Por exemplo, alguns dispositivos de rede podem ser configurados para ignorar pacotes ICMP, resultando em respostas negativas mesmo quando o dispositivo está funcional. Além disso, o ping não fornece informações detalhadas sobre a largura de banda ou a qualidade da conexão, limitando sua eficácia em diagnósticos mais complexos. Portanto, é importante usar o ping em conjunto com outras ferramentas de monitoramento para obter uma visão mais completa da performance da rede.
Uso do Ping em Ambientes Corporativos
Em ambientes corporativos, o ping é frequentemente utilizado como parte de uma estratégia mais ampla de monitoramento de rede. Muitas empresas implementam soluções de monitoramento que utilizam o ping para verificar a disponibilidade de servidores e serviços críticos. Essas soluções podem enviar alertas em tempo real quando a latência ultrapassa um determinado limite ou quando um dispositivo não responde, permitindo que as equipes de TI atuem rapidamente para resolver problemas antes que afetem os usuários finais.